As of 2010-2014, the total population of Peyton is 329. The Peyton population density is 143.21 people per square mile, which is much higher than the state average density of 49.93 people per square mile and is higher than the national average density of 82.73 people per square mile. The most prevalent race in Peyton is white, which represent 78.42% of the total population. The average Peyton education level is about the same as the state average and is higher than the national average.
